Director Homer John Livingston bought 26,343 shares of FCEL at $18.79 on 2026-07-16 (first position, $495.0K), stock now -51.2% from 52-week high.

Director Iii Homer John Livingston initiated a substantial 26,343-share position in FuelCell Energy by purchasing $495.0K worth at $18.79 per share. The company is unprofitable with full-year net income of $-77.9M, though it reported annual revenue growth of +41.0%. The stock has declined 51.2% from its 52-week high of $37.88 and is down 7.7% over the trailing 30 days, trading at $18.50 today—near the purchase price—despite a strong 90-day appreciation of +155.2% prior to this transaction date. This inaugural stake by a board member in a capital-intensive hydrogen fuel cell company warrants attention to underlying operational and strategic context, particularly given the company's ongoing losses and volatile price action.
